What is the issue, problem, or challenge?
There are many military families that face hardship due to injury, illness and even death. Our soldiers and/or their surviving family members have made huge sacrifices for their country. We would like to ease their minds and give back by providing meals for them during the holiday season.
How will this project solve this problem?
This project will keep the spirits of our military heroes and their families high throughout the holiday season. Helping to feed these families will give these troubled families one less thing to worry about.
